ACPL-302J 2.5 Amp Gate Drive Optocoupler with Integrated Flyback Controller for Isolated DC-DC Converter, IGBT DESAT Detection, Active Miller Clamping, FAULT and UVLO Status Feedback Data Sheet Lead (Pb) Free RoHS 6 fully compliant RoHS 6 fully compliant options available; -xxxE denotes a lead-free product Description Avago's ACPL-302J 2.5 Amp Gate Drive Optocoupler features integrated flyback controller for isolated DC-DC converter, IGBT desaturation sensing with fault feedback and soft-shutdown, Under-Voltage LockOut (UVLO) with feedback and active Miller current clamping. The fast propagation delay with excellent timing skew performance enables excellent timing control and efficiency. This full feature optocoupler comes in a compact, surfacemountable SO-16 package for space-savings, is suitable for driving IGBTs and power MOSFETs used in motor control and inverter applications. Features • Integrated flyback controller for isolated DC-DC converter • Regulated Output Voltage: 20 V • Peak output current: 2.5 A max. • Miller Clamp Sinking Current: 1.7 A max. • Wide Input Voltage Range: 8 V to 18 V • Common-Mode Rejection (CMR): > 30 kV/ms at VCM = 1500 V • Propagation delay: 250 ns max. • Integrated fail-safe IGBT protection – Desat detection, “Soft” IGBT turn-off and Fault Feedback – Under Voltage Lock-Out (UVLO) protection with Feedback • High Noise Immunity – Miller Current Clamping – Direct LED input with low input impedance and low noise sensitivity – Negat.
